Evidence for the Direct Two-Photon Transition from (3686) to J/

Abstract

The two-photon transition (3686)γγ J/ is studied in a sample of 106 million (3686) decays collected by the BESIII detector. The branching fraction is measured to be (3.10.6(stat)+0.8-1.0(syst)) ×10-4 using J/ e+e- and J/μ+μ- decays, and its upper limit is estimated to be 4.5×10-4 at the 90% conference level. This work represents the first measurement of a two-photon transition among charmonium states. The orientation of the (3686) decay plane and the J/ polarization in this decay are also studied. In addition, the product branching fractions of sequential E1 transitions (3686)γcJ, cJγ J/ (J=0,1,2) are reported.
